Dycom Industries Delivers Record-Breaking Results in Q2 2027


On August 26, 2026, Dycom Industries Inc. announced its fiscal 2027 second quarter results, exceeding expectations and solidifying the company's position as a leader in digital and critical infrastructure.

The quarterly revenue reached $2.01 billion, marking a 45.6% year-over-year growth and 16.7% organic increase. Total Adjusted EBITDA of $315.5 million grew 54% year over year, representing 15.7% of revenues and exceeding the high end of Dycom's outlook.

Adjusted EPS of $5.29 grew 45% year over year, also surpassing the high end of the company's outlook and demonstrating its ability to deliver attractive returns for shareholders as its platform scales.

Dycom's President and Chief Executive Officer, Dan Peyovich, highlighted the company's strong results, citing record organic first-half revenue, increased profitability, and above-market growth. He also mentioned securing significant new awards that support continued confidence in Dycom's growth trajectory.

The company's leadership is evident in its Q2 performance, with a record quarterly revenue and robust demand across its portfolio. Demand for fiber-to-the-home, long-haul, data center interconnects, and data center electrical and structured cabling systems remains high, with customer activity just as strong or even stronger than a quarter ago.
